Role Summary

Responsibilities: You will support with a wide range of motion design projects for our clients within the healthcare sector, from initial concept development to full production, allowing for real autonomy and creativity.

Salary: A pro-rated salary of £26,250 per annum outside of London (£28,860 per annum in London).

Benefits: Statutory holiday allowance, flexible working hours and the chance to work from home 1 day per week, numerous internal training and mentoring opportunities and employer pension contributions.

Role Type: Full-time, temporary internship, lasting for either 3 or 6 months.

Start Date: This role will ideally commence in August or September 2026, and you will be asked to state your availability on your application form.

Application Deadlines: While there are no set application deadlines, we strongly recommend applying as early as possible. The role will close when a suitable candidate is found.

Location: This role is available in our Global Headquarters in Cambridge, as well as our London, Manchester and Bristol offices.

About the Role: This internship is ideal for design students or recent graduates who would like to gain insight into an agency or commercial environment, as well as those looking to kickstart a career in design. In this role, you will support with a wide range of motion design projects, including planning and delivering small-scale on-site filming, detailed 2D and 3D animation, short “explainer” video creation, developing interactive visuals for internal teams and external clients, as well as post-production video and audio editing tailored to various platforms and events. We are therefore looking for talented individuals with a great understanding of aesthetics and meticulous attention to detail. Collaborating with experienced members of our Creative team, you will receive comprehensive training and gain hands-on design experience in the healthcare sector.

About Costello Medical: Costello Medical is a rapidly growing global healthcare agency specialising in medical communications, market access, and health economic and outcomes research. We work with a wide range of clients, including the industry’s most successful pharmaceutical and medical technology companies, patient and public health bodies, and charitable organisations.

Requirements About You: This internship is suited to recent graduates, as well as current students who can complete full-time internships over the holidays or via a placement as a part of their degree. We also welcome applications from those looking to begin their career in the creative industry.

  • Essential requirements for the role are:
  • A degree-level or higher qualification in a design-related discipline (minimum or expected 2.1), in addition to a highly innovative portfolio.
  • Excellent technical skills in Adobe After Effects or Premiere Pro.
  • Proven experience developing and delivering creative concepts.
  • A strong understanding of aesthetics and meticulous attention to detail.
  • A problem-solving mindset with the ability to think outside the box.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• The ability to take initiative and work independently, as well as collaboratively within a team.
  • Strong organisational skills and the ability to manage conflicting deadlines.
  • Desired requirements for the role are:
  • Knowledge of other Adobe software such as Illustrator, Photoshop, and Audition, as well as 3D software like Cinema 4D.
  • Some experience in filming, with knowledge of pre-production and post-production processes.
  • A keen interest in applying motion design to the healthcare sector.
